NASA/JPL's Cassini Mission Site Wins Webbys!

The Cassini mission web site, http://saturn.jpl.nasa.gov/, was voted Best Science Site in this year’s Peoples Voice Webby awards! A big congrats to the web team – and the entire mission team as well – for the recognition of excellence. I know I cast my vote for the site, as it’s well-made and a daily source of invaluable information for Lights in the Dark.

Other nominees in the category were Nature.com, the Scientific American site, Wired.com and the Exploratorium Evidence: How Do We Know What We Know site. A list of all the Webby award winners can be seen here.

NASA’s main site also won for Best Government Site.
